Proper noun
A watercourse:
A creek, a tributary of the Driftwood River, in Indiana.
A different creek, a tributary of the Wabash River, in Indiana.
A stream in Tennessee, a tributary of Duck River.
A stream in Minnesota.
A tributary of the Tuscarawas River, Ohio.
A tributary of the Susquehanna River, Pennsylvania.
A community in the United States:
An unincorporated community in Moral Township, Shelby County, Indiana.
A city in Clay County and Jackson County, Missouri.
A town in Walworth County, Wisconsin.
A number of townships in the United States, listed under Sugar Creek Township.
